Understanding Exhaust System Components

An effective exhaust system consists of several key components:

  • Headers: Collect exhaust gases from engine cylinders.
  • Mid-pipes: Connect headers to the muffler, affecting sound and flow.
  • Muffler: Reduces noise while influencing sound tone.
  • Exhaust tips: Final aesthetic and sound tuning element.

Designing for Sound Optimization

To achieve the desired sound profile, consider the following factors:

  • Muffler type: Choose between chambered, straight-through, or adaptive mufflers based on sound preference.
  • Pipe diameter: Larger diameters generally produce deeper sounds but may affect performance.
  • Resonators: Add or modify resonators to fine-tune tone and reduce drone.

Balancing Performance and Sound

Optimizing for both performance and sound requires careful selection of components:

  • Material choices: Stainless steel offers durability and sound quality.
  • Flow design: Smooth, mandrel-bent pipes reduce backpressure and enhance power.
  • Catalytic converters: Select models that minimize performance loss while meeting emissions standards.

Installation Tips and Best Practices

Proper installation ensures optimal performance and sound. Consider these tips:

  • Use high-quality clamps and hangers to prevent leaks and rattles.
  • Ensure correct pipe alignment to avoid unnecessary stress on components.
  • Test the system on a dyno or road to fine-tune sound and performance.
